The Schwer FreezeGuard Winter Work Gloves are designed to keep your hands warm and dry in cold, wet conditions, making them a solid choice for ice fishing and other outdoor winter tasks. They use waterproof polyester coated with latex, which reliably blocks water, wind, and cold air. The gloves include an acrylic terry liner that provides good insulation, effective down to about -22°F, so your hands can stay warm without bulky layers.

A standout feature is their foam latex palm, which offers a strong grip on slippery tools or ice, helping prevent accidents. The gloves remain flexible in freezing weather thanks to a double latex coating that avoids stiffness, so you can still easily handle fishing gear or perform detailed tasks. They also avoid PFAS chemicals, which can irritate sensitive skin during extended wear. Fit and comfort seem well considered, with a bright orange color for visibility and a size large option.

These gloves provide decent dexterity but are thicker than some specialized fishing gloves, so very fine finger movements may feel a bit restricted. Additionally, they are work gloves rather than fishing-specific gloves, so some fish-friendly features like quick drying or ultra-thin fingertips might be lacking. They deliver strong waterproofing, warmth, and grip for cold-weather fishing and outdoor work, especially when durable protection against snow and ice is needed, but may be less suitable if maximum finger sensitivity is required.

The KastKing Mountain Mist Cold Weather Fishing Gloves are designed to keep your hands warm and functional during cold-weather fishing, ice fishing, or even hunting and photography. They use neoprene material with a fleece-lined back for insulation, which helps retain warmth. The gloves feature a waterproof back and a durable microfiber and neoprene palm coated with an anti-slip polymer pattern, providing a good grip on slippery gear in wet conditions.

One standout feature is the half-finger design with hook-and-loop straps that let you fold back finger tips individually, allowing precise tasks like tying hooks or using a smartphone without fully exposing your hands to cold. This design boosts dexterity while still offering warmth and protection. The gloves also have touchscreen-compatible fingertips, which is convenient for checking phones or cameras without removing the gloves. The fit is adjustable via the wrist closure, helping keep cold air out and ensuring comfort. However, because of the half-finger style, fingers not folded back may get cold in extremely harsh conditions, so they may be less suited for those needing full finger coverage. The medium size fits many adults and the ambidextrous design is versatile, but proper sizing is important for comfort and dexterity.

These gloves represent a smart choice for anyone seeking warmth combined with the ability to work with their hands easily in cold, wet environments, especially for fishing or other related outdoor activities.

The Glacier Glove Unisex Alaska Pro is a solid choice for cold-weather fishing and other outdoor activities like hunting and hiking. Made with durable goat skin leather on the palms, these gloves offer excellent grip and long-lasting wear, important when handling slippery fish or wet gear. Their waterproof exterior helps keep your hands dry, which is essential for comfort during wet or snowy conditions. Inside, the Thinsulate lining provides good insulation to keep your hands warm without too much bulk.

One standout feature is the gloves' touchscreen compatibility, so you won’t need to take them off to use your phone or tablet, a helpful convenience when you’re out in the cold. The gloves are designed to balance warmth and flexibility, allowing decent finger movement and dexterity, which is important for tasks like tying knots or baiting hooks.

In terms of fit and comfort, these gloves come in a unisex large size and are constructed with reinforced seams for durability, but sizing may vary, so checking the fit before purchase is recommended. They require gentle hand washing and air drying to maintain their quality. While these gloves perform well in cold, wet environments, if you need ultra-fine finger dexterity (for example, very delicate tasks), thicker insulation might feel a bit restrictive. Also, as leather gloves, they may require more care compared to synthetic options. The Alaska Pro gloves provide a dependable, warm, and versatile option for anglers and outdoor enthusiasts who need a balance of protection, grip, and touchscreen use in cold weather.

Buying Guide for the Best Cold Weather Fishing Gloves

When it comes to cold-weather fishing, having the right gloves can make a significant difference in your comfort and performance. The right pair of gloves will keep your hands warm, dry, and dexterous, allowing you to focus on your fishing rather than the cold. To choose the best cold-weather fishing gloves, you need to consider several key specifications that will help you find the perfect fit for your needs.
MaterialThe material of the gloves is crucial as it determines warmth, flexibility, and water resistance. Common materials include neoprene, wool, and synthetic blends. Neoprene is excellent for water resistance and insulation, making it ideal for extremely cold and wet conditions. Wool provides natural warmth and breathability but may not be as water-resistant. Synthetic blends often offer a balance of warmth, flexibility, and water resistance. Choose a material based on the typical weather conditions you fish in and your need for dexterity.
InsulationInsulation is what keeps your hands warm in cold weather. Gloves can have varying levels of insulation, from lightweight to heavy-duty. Lightweight insulation is suitable for milder cold or if you need more finger dexterity. Medium insulation offers a balance of warmth and flexibility, making it versatile for different conditions. Heavy-duty insulation is best for extremely cold environments but may reduce finger movement. Consider the average temperatures you will be fishing in and how much dexterity you need when choosing the level of insulation.
WaterproofingWaterproofing is essential to keep your hands dry, especially when fishing in wet conditions or handling fish. Some gloves are fully waterproof, while others are water-resistant. Fully waterproof gloves are ideal for heavy rain or snow, but they may be less breathable. Water-resistant gloves offer some protection from moisture while allowing better airflow. Think about how often you will be exposed to water and whether you prioritize dryness or breathability.
DexterityDexterity refers to how easily you can move your fingers and perform tasks while wearing the gloves. High dexterity is important for tasks like tying knots, handling bait, and operating fishing gear. Gloves with thinner materials or articulated fingers offer better dexterity but may provide less warmth. Thicker gloves with more insulation may limit finger movement. Assess the type of fishing activities you will be doing and how much finger mobility you need.
GripA good grip is essential for handling fishing rods, reels, and slippery fish. Gloves with textured palms or fingers provide better grip, even when wet. Some gloves have rubberized or silicone patterns to enhance grip. If you often handle fish or need a secure hold on your gear, look for gloves with enhanced grip features. Consider the type of fishing you do and how important a strong grip is for your activities.
Fit and ComfortThe fit and comfort of the gloves are important for prolonged use. Gloves should fit snugly without being too tight, allowing for good blood circulation and warmth. Look for gloves with adjustable cuffs or straps to ensure a secure fit. Comfort features like soft linings, ergonomic designs, and pre-curved fingers can enhance your overall experience. Try on different sizes and styles to find the most comfortable fit for your hands.
